WHY THIS ROLE IS IMPORTANT TO US

At SimCorp, we facilitate the streamlining of investments, accounting, and operations for major global financial institutions. We do this through IT systems, processes, and financial knowledge. Implementing our software by way of high-quality projects is at the core of what we do. To introduce our software to our clients, business consultants are essential to us.

In the role of Lead Business Consultant specializing in Data Management and Data Integration, your participation will be instrumental in the expansion of our market unit and in advancing the outcomes of our clients' projects. You will normally be working full-time on implementation projects, which require your special expertise in Data Management and Data Integration, and you will be responsible for all aspects of the project stream. You will act as an important sparring partner for your clients and effectively monitor, coordinate, and escalate issues as needed.

WHAT YOU WILL BE RESPONSIBLE FOR

  • Responsibility for major parts of SimCorp One® implementation projects: You know the customer requirements and processes related to Investment Operations at banks, asset managers and insurers and outline solutions for optimal use of SimCorp One® 

  • Close cooperation with the project manager and key role in developing projects to success 

  • Gain understanding of SimCorp’s Global Standard Solutions and utilize them for project delivery 

  • Key contact for our customers for all questions in connection with SimCorp One® 

  • Instruct and mentor less experienced colleagues on the job 

  • Contribute to improving best practices for implementation processes and promote topics across projects 

  • Engage in know-how exchange with colleagues on an international level

WHAT WE VALUE

Most importantly, you can see yourself contributing and thriving in the position described above. How you gained the skills needed for doing that is less important. We expect you to have expertise at several of the following:

Previous experience as an Analyst or (Implementation) Consultant for asset managers, asset owners, banks or consulting firms 

  • Solid know-how in at least two of the following areas:

  • Enterprise Data Management 

  • Data Integration architecture, patterns and standards WS*, REST API, JSON, XML, XSLT and other scripting languages like Phyton. Relational Databases: Oracle, SQL Server and/or ETL tools C# or any other object-oriented language 

  • Testing e.g., Test-Driven Development, agile testing, test automation, test methodologies 

  • System performance improvements. Continuous integration and delivery (CI/CD) 

  • Experience working on software implementation projects in the financial industry. Basic understanding of financial industry/products and related workflows 

  • Direct experience with SimCorp One® / SimCorp Dimension (SCD) is a plus

  • Ability to travel to client’s site

  • Can attend the SimCorp office 2x/week as per our hybrid policy

WHO WE ARE 

For over 50 years, we have worked closely with investment and asset managers to become the world’s leading provider of integrated investment management solutions. We are 3,000+ colleagues with a broad range of nationalities, education, professional experiences, ages, and backgrounds in general.

SimCorp is an independent subsidiary of the Deutsche Börse Group. Following the recent merger with Axioma, we leverage the combined strength of our brands to provide an industry-leading, full, front-to-back offering for our clients, with SimCorp as the overarching company brand and Axioma as a key product brand.
